Mapping Clinical Placements: Organisation and Capacity Building


Health Workforce Australia (HWA) is seeking tenders from suitably qualified organisations to undertake an extensive and detailed Australia-wide consultation and information gathering process across the health and education sectors.

This project will establish an evidence base to inform decisions necessary for the implementation of the Council of Australian Governments (COAG) reform measures to increase the capacity of clinical training in Australia. A key measure of the reform package is the funding of clinical placements for professional entry health courses, which will act as a lever to create greater capacity in the system. This will be supported by the establishment of Integrated Regional Training Networks that will have a pivotal role in facilitating, identifying and aligning new placements across the higher education and clinical training sectors.

This project will involve consultations with all universities and their respective teaching departments, existing and potential placement providers, state and territory jurisdictions, and other stakeholders, groups or organisations that have an interest in the organisation, management and delivery of clinical placements such as university departments of rural health, rural clinical schools and GP training providers.

Tenderers should ideally have the capacity to mobilise a project team nationally, and may therefore seek to form a consortium or partnership to ensure appropriate coverage of all states and territories. Alternatively, tenderers may choose to submit proposals to undertake the project in specific states and territories.
